Question

Atomicity of calcium phosphate will be

A 12

B 13

C 17

D 15

Open in App
Solution

Atomicity is the number of atoms in the molecules of an element.

Calcium Phosphate is
Ca subscript 3 left parenthesis PO subscript 4 right parenthesis subscript 2 It space consists space of space 3 space Ca space atoms 2 thin space straight P space atoms and space 4 asterisk times 2 equals 8 space straight O space atoms hence space atomicity space equals space 3 plus 2 plus 8 equals 13
